码迷,mamicode.com
首页 > 编程语言 > 详细

Go 语言环境搭建

时间:2015-05-18 12:44:47      阅读:226      评论:0      收藏:0      [点我收藏+]

标签:

本文内容

  • 概述
  • Go SDK
  • LiteIDE
  • 参考资料

2009年Google推出了它的第二个开源语言 Go。对 Go 的评价褒贬不一,中国比国外的热情高中国比国外的热情高。Go 天生就是为并发和网络而生的,除了这点外,在静态编译、GC、跨平台、易学、丰富的标准库等,其实并不如 C/C++、Java、C#、Python。由此可想而知,为什么会出现 Go?以及为什么 Go 存在如此多的问题和争论?——也许Go 更像是一个“天才的自闭症患者”,如果看清了这点,对 Go 的褒贬也就能泰然啦~

下载

概述

开发 Go 一般需要两个程序:

本文以 Windows 7 64 位为环境,go1.4.2.windows-amd64 和 liteidex27.2.1.windows-qt5 为例。

Go SDK

技术分享

图 1 Go SDK

默认安装路径为 C:\go 下。当然你可以更改该路径,只要在后续配置 IDE 时,使用正确的路径即可。

安装完成后,Go SDK 会自动为你添加系统环境变量。

现在,你可以用任何文本编辑器来编写 Go 代码,比如 HelloWorld.go,保存在 C 盘根路径下:

package main
 
import (
    "fmt"
)
 
func main() {
    fmt.Println("Hello World!")
}

然后,你就可以通过运行 go run HelloWorld.go 来执行这个程序。

C:\>go run HelloWorld.go
hello, world
 
C:\>

LiteIDE

如果不想用命令行,可以用 IDE 环境——LiteIDE,只需对 IDE 进行相应的配置即可。

下载 LiteIDE 压缩文件,解压为 “liteide”后,双击 “{你的路径}\liteide\bin\liteide.exe”就可以看见如下界面:

技术分享

图 2 liteIDE 主界面

配置 liteIDE,点击菜单栏“查看->选项”,会看见如图 3 所示:

技术分享

图 3 配置 liteIDE

左边选择“LiteIDE”,右边选择你的环境,比如,我的是 Windows 7 64 位,就选 win64-user.env,双击后,会看见该配置文件的内容:、

# native compiler windows amd64
 
GOROOT=C:\Go
#GOBIN=
GOARCH=amd64
GOOS=windows
CGO_ENABLED=1
 
PATH=%GOROOT%\bin;%PATH%
 
LITEIDE_GDB=gdb64
LITEIDE_MAKE=mingw32-make
LITEIDE_TERM=%COMSPEC%
LITEIDE_TERMARGS=
LITEIDE_EXEC=%COMSPEC%
LITEIDE_EXECOPT=/C

除了 win64-user.env 外,还有 win64.env,前者是用户配置文件,后者是整个机器的配置文件,因为 Windows 操作系统是多用户的。

确保 GOROOT=C:\ 行,是你机器的实际 Go SDK 的路径即可,比如,我的路径其默认路径 C:\Go

工作路径。你可以为 LiteIDE 配置工作路径。选择工具栏”Go图标”,会看见图 4 所示:

技术分享

图 4 配置工作路径

你可以看见两个路径,第一个是我自定义的,第二个是系统默认的。

参考资料

Go 语言环境搭建

标签:

原文地址:http://www.cnblogs.com/liuning8023/p/4511471.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!